What is Forecast Commander?

Most budgeting apps tell you where the money went. Forecast Commander also tells you what is coming. The forecast shows how far ahead you are clear and which day gets tightest. Your budget reads from the calendar, so it counts the bills still coming, not only the ones that have posted.

Budget your way. By category with rollover, zero-based, or by pay period, so a check every other week gets a budget every other week and the leftover at the end of each period is the number you can apply to debt or savings. Scenarios give you a date instead of a feeling. When can I afford this, and what changes if rent goes up. See the day you are debt-free, with avalanche and snowball side by side and the date under each. Reserve money for a goal without moving it and watch the forecast stop counting it.

It never connects to your bank and doesn't rely on AI on purpose. You type what you know, a statement export from your bank finds the bills that repeat, and unplanned spending gets entered as you spend. No feed to reconnect, no guesses to correct, no credentials anywhere but with your bank. It is not for everyone, and the site says so.

Runs in any browser on desktop or phone. Thirty-five days free, no card. Made by an independent developer.
